Leveraging Technology for Medication Compliance in Senior Care: The Role of Elderly Companion Services
Elderly companion services have become a pivotal component in enhancing medication compliance among seniors, leveraging advanced technologies to ensure their well-being. These services integrate smart technology solutions, such as automated pill dispensers and reminder systems, tailored to the specific medication regimens of individual clients. By providing timely alerts and reminders through user-friendly devices like tablets or smartphones, these services help seniors manage their dosages correctly. This not only improves adherence to prescribed treatment plans but also decreases the risk of missed or incorrectly taken medications, which can be particularly detrimental to elderly individuals with complex health conditions. Moreover, companion services often include remote monitoring capabilities, allowing caregivers to track medication intake patterns and intervene promptly should any discrepancies arise, ensuring a higher level of safety and peace of mind for both seniors and their families.
The integration of elderly companion services in senior care is a step towards a more proactive approach to health management. These services go beyond mere reminders; they facilitate a continuous dialogue between the elder and their support network. This interaction can be instrumental in identifying potential issues with medication, such as side effects or a decline in overall health, enabling timely medical intervention. Additionally, these services often employ cloud-based platforms that enable healthcare providers to access up-to-date information on the senior’s medication schedule, fostering better coordination and communication among all parties involved in the care process. This seamless integration of technology empowers seniors to maintain their independence while ensuring they receive the necessary support to manage their medications effectively.
Customizing Medication Reminders for Seniors: Strategies and Solutions by Elderly Companion Services
Elderly Companion Services recognizes the importance of medication adherence for seniors, who often juggle multiple prescriptions with varying dosage schedules. To address this challenge, the service provides customized medication reminders tailored to individual needs and preferences. These reminders are designed to integrate seamlessly into the daily routines of elderly patients, utilizing a combination of alerts via mobile devices, landline phones, or even simple alarm systems for those with limited tech access. The personalized approach ensures that each reminder is not just a prompt but a part of the patient’s daily life, making it easier to adhere to complex medication schedules. Furthermore, Elderly Companion Services employs trained professionals who work closely with healthcare providers to monitor and adjust reminder settings as necessary, ensuring that any changes in treatment are accurately reflected in the reminders sent to seniors. This proactive and adaptive system helps to minimize the risk of missed doses or incorrect medication use, thereby supporting the overall health and well-being of older adults.
